1

我之前问过一个关于设计接收视频文件的服务的问题,将它们发送到编码服务,等待编码完成,然后下载文件。

我开始为此编写代码,我的一位同事建议我使用 .Net 4.0 的新功能,而不是使用 BackgroundWorker 编写它。我做了一些阅读,并行功能听起来很棒。我应该实现更多新功能吗?我是.net 4.0 的新手。

谢谢!

4

1 回答 1

1

Parallel Extensions 无疑是一个不错的选择。您可能要考虑的另一个是Reactive Extensions,它实现了“推送”模型。你需要花一点时间来理解它,但它非常优雅 - 并且可能与你的异步模型一起工作得很好。

于 2010-09-17T16:00:14.363 回答